How much does it cost to rent a home in Cambridge?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Cambridge 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,649 | $1,750 | $10,000+ |
Cambridge 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,461 | $1,325 | $10,000+ |
Cambridge 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,409 | $1,075 | $10,000+ |
Cambridge 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,453 | $975 | $10,000+ |
Cambridge 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,689 | $1,050 | $10,000+ |
Cambridge 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,546 | $1,050 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cambridge
What type of rentals are currently available in Cambridge?
There are currently 22152 Apartments for Rent in Cambridge, MA with pricing that ranges from $850 to $50,000. There are also 14405 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Cambridge ranging from $920 to $45,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Cambridge?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Cambridge ranges from $920 to $45,000 with an average monthly rent of $5,500.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Cambridge?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Cambridge range from $1,050 to $28,200,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,325 to $45,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,075 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$850.
